Transaction

8d374362e39d2f7fd5a95224b760fe2a77b9a0386eda9343957745bb5c33ce66

Summary

In Block239417
TimeFri, 23 Jun 2023 17:29:00 UTC
Total Input500.23209635 Nebula
Total Output555.23209635 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
727622 Confirmations555.23209635 Nebula
Raw Transaction